Briiz in Malta is looking to recruit an Operations Executive to join their team on a full-time basis.
Main duties and responsibilities include:
Communicating with clients to set up jobs and visits to their properties;
Taking bookings both over the phone and via email;
Keeping the roster up-to-date and in real-time;
Effecting roster changes, including those last minute, such as emergency leave and sick leave;
Communicating with clients when their regular cleaner is unable to attend;
Monitor leave balances of employees and approve/decline requests in communication with HR;
Following up on clients requests after jobs (for example to set up a second visit if we need to);
Making sure checklists are all in order;
Taking charge of products brought back after jobs and making sure they’re cycled to be able to go out again whilst making sure that the warehouse is kept in order;
Assisting supervisors by making sure they’re on time to jobs and answering their queries;
Run stock takes for client keys and equipment;
Raise any need for re-ordering products;
Follow-up on client complaints;
Make sure that jobs are being closed off on our systems accordingly (pictures on jobs, jobs closed for invoicing, client signature uploaded, etc);
Manage our tasks app (Basecamp) and following up to make sure everything is closed off accordingly;
General day-to-day operational duties.
Requirements:
2-3 years experience in the same field;
Additional training will be provided.
